在Swagger或RAML中记录基于消息的API

时间:2017-04-20 11:23:38

标签: swagger raml

我们如何在Swagger或RAML中记录基于消息的API? 基于消息我的意思是端点始终是相同的,但是可以向该端点发送多种消息类型,并且根据输入消息的类型,我们得到不同的响应。 我可以看看这种类型的API的例子吗?

谢谢。  路易斯奥斯卡

1 个答案:

答案 0 :(得分:3)

Swagger和OAS特别用于记录类似REST的API。经过长时间的搜索,我找到了AsyncAPI规范。这可用于记录您的消息驱动API。

还有一个在线编辑器,如果你已经熟悉使用swagger,yaml很容易开始使用这个规范